
Monday Night Poker at Club Evans was a thrilling success, with local hero Brad Cleaver claiming victory and fending off travellers to secure the crown. Congratulations to Brad for his impressive win!
Top Finishers:
1. Brad Cleaver: Taking home the win and proving the strength of the local players.
2. Jaymie: A consistent performer, always in the money, and making the trip worthwhile.
3. Andrew: A local lad showing his skills and claiming the 3rd place spot.
4. Charlie: Making his debut at Evans, Charlie from the Ballina area not only participated in his first game but also carried the Bounty!
It was also a special night as we welcomed a player all the way from Canada to join in the fun. This diverse turnout showcases how a friendly, fun, and welcoming atmosphere can attract players from around the globe.
